小程序中的JS文件主要是用来处理 用户操作和获取用户信息等与后端进行交互 。例如:获取用户信息、用户点击按钮后的逻辑操作、获取用户位置、跳转用户点击的链接等等。🧀小程序的JS文件分为三类 ● app.js:整个小程序项目的入口文件,通过APP()函数来启动整个小程序。● 页面内的js:页面入口文件,通过Page()函数...
2.6 app.wxss 和每个 page 的wxss 的覆盖关系是: 如果有同名 rule 的话,page 会覆盖 app 的,不是merge是覆盖。3. JS 3.1 JS 的运行环境和view的运行环境是隔离的。JS只能通过事件获取时机和setData方法修改数据来改变view。3.2 JS 目前有个很大的问题是无法获取到页面px级的宽度高度, 所有事件回调的单...
🍇小程序代码的构成 - WXSS 样式 1. 什么是 WXSS WXSS (WeiXin Style Sheets)是一套 样式语言 ,用于描述 WXML 的组件样式,类似于网页开发中的 CSS。 2. WXSS 和 CSS 的区别 ① 新增了 rpx 尺寸单位 CSS 中需要手动进行像素单位换算,例如 rem WXSS 在底层支持新的尺寸单位 rpx,在不同大小的屏幕上小程序...
对的没错,写法与平时写HTML代码类似,只不过换成了等等标签仅此而已,语法格式也是同理。 ⭐ 二、wxss 用于页面的样式,相当于网页中的 .css 文件 这一点与之前不同的是,我们所写的样式文件不是写在与html代码那个页面,而是像引入外部js文件一样。我们写在一个专属的页面,小程序会自动解析不需要我们引入到html...
简介:【微信小程序】--WXML & WXSS & JS 逻辑交互介绍(四) 一、小程序页面 新建小程序页面 小程序页面创建是非常简单的,只需要在app.json->pages中新增页面的存放路径,微信开发者工具就会帮我们自动创建对应的页面文件🥰。 {"pages":["pages/index/index","pages/logs/logs","pages/CshPage1/Csh...
下面将从WXML、WXSS、JS、JSON四个方面介绍它们的命名规则。 一、WXML命名规则 1. 文件命名:WXML文件的命名应使用有意义的名称,使用小写字母和中划线连接,例如:index.wxml、detail.wxml等。 2. 标签命名:WXML中的标签命名应该具有描述性,且以小写字母和中划线连接,例如:view、text、image等。 3. 类名和ID命名:...
03.wxml,wxss,js 数据绑定({{}}): WXML 通过 {{变量名}} 来绑定 WXML 文件和对应的 JavaScript 文件中的 data 对象属性。 例: <view>{{msg}}</view>//输出:hello data:{msg:"hello"} 注意:没有被定义的变量的或者是被设置为 undefined 的变量不会被同步到 wxml 中。
每一页面都具有wxml,wxss,js,json文件,但比不是必须的,小程序和网页类似,一种以html+css+js,而小程序则是wxml+wxss+js,如wxml用来描述页面结构,wxss用例描述页面的样式,js用来添加逻辑信息的。 wxml wxml用来构建页面的结构 //数据绑定 <!--wxml--> <view> {{message}} </view> // page.js Page({...
1.项目根目录中的app.wxss会作用域所有的小程序页面 2.局部页面的.wxss样式仅对当前页面生效 wxss仅支持部分css选择器 1..class和id 2.element 3.并集选择器、后代选择器 4.::after和::before等位类选择器 JS逻辑交互 小程序中的.js文件 一个项目·不仅仅能够展示界面,我们通过.js文件来处理用户的操作。例如...
之前学了 vue2.5,并且做了一个模仿 去哪网界面,越是学的后面,越是发现 vue 的语法和微信小程序的语法是非常相似,这次把微信小程序基础重新捡起来,毕竟从去年暑假学完小程序到现在过去了挺长时间的,这次基础语法迅速过一遍,就开始做项目了,冲冲冲 一、学习记录 view 标签 和 text 标签 插值表达式的使用,js 后端...